Ryan Christian Kwanten (born 28 November 1976) is an Australian actor and producer. He is famous for playing Vinnie Patterson in the Australian TV show Home and Away and Jason Stackhouse in the American fantasy series True Blood.

Kwanten started his career in Australia before moving to the United States to star in bigger shows and movies. He has acted in many different types of stories, from dramas and comedies to horror and science fiction. He has also worked as a producer, helping to create the shows he stars in.

Early Life and Education

Ryan Kwanten was born in Sydney, Australia, and grew up in a town called Terrigal, New South Wales. He has two brothers, Mitchell, who is a musician, and Lloyd, who is a doctor. His mother, Kris, worked for a charity, and his father, Eddie, who is Dutch, worked for a government marine agency.

For high school, Ryan went to St Paul's Catholic College. After graduating, he studied at The University of Sydney and earned a degree in commerce, which is the study of business and trade.

Acting Career

Starting in Australia

Kwanten began his acting journey on Australian television shows like A Country Practice and Hey Dad..!. His first big role came in 1997 when he joined the popular TV drama Home and Away as the lifeguard Vinnie Patterson. He played this character for five years and became a well-known face in Australia. In 2002, he decided to leave the show to look for new acting opportunities.

Moving to Hollywood

After leaving Home and Away, Kwanten moved to the United States. He was soon cast in the American teen drama series Summerland, where he played Jay Robertson. He also started appearing in movies. He was in the family film Flicka (2006) and had the main role in the horror movie Dead Silence (2007).

His biggest international role came in 2008 when he was cast as Jason Stackhouse in the HBO fantasy series True Blood. The show, which was about humans and vampires living together, was a huge hit and ran for seven seasons until 2014. Kwanten's performance made him famous around the world.

Recent Roles

Kwanten has continued to act in a variety of interesting projects. In 2010, he voiced the character Kludd in the animated movie Legend of the Guardians: The Owls of Ga'Hoole. He also starred in the Australian film Red Hill.

He played a superhero character in the short film Truth in Journalism (2013) and a Viking warrior in the action movie Northmen: A Viking Saga (2014). In 2015, he was the voice of the famous cartoon koala Blinky Bill in Blinky Bill the Movie.

From 2018 to 2019, he starred in and produced the crime drama series The Oath. More recently, he appeared in the science fiction film 2067 (2020) and the horror series Them (2021). In 2022, he played a key role in Kindred, a TV series based on a famous novel by Octavia E. Butler.

Awards and Recognition

Ryan Kwanten's work has been recognized with several awards and nominations.

  • In 2009, the cast of True Blood, including Kwanten, won a Satellite Award for Best Ensemble in a Television Series.
  • In 2010, he received a Breakthrough Award from the organization Australians in Film, which honors Australian actors who have become successful internationally.
  • He has also been nominated for awards from the Screen Actors Guild, the Teen Choice Awards, and the Australian Film Institute.
